How to Ship Your One Of a Kind Antiques & Buys After Market

Did you find that one of a kind antique or perfect statement piece during High Point Market?  You are not alone!  In the moment, it can be easy to fall in love with a piece, but then comes figuring out how to get it home.  We have some answers for you that can hopefully make this a reality.

W Design, located here in High Point, North Carolina, provides packaging and shipping through FedEx, UPS, USPS, and other companies, if necessary. They have experience packing fragile items and offer everything from foam and bubble wrapping to edge or corner padding.

JWS Transport is based out of Atlanta, Georgia but they have a warehouse in High Point, North Carolina. They deliver coast to coast and offer in home delivery.

The Packaging Center, located in High Point, North Carolina, is known for crating all the antiques that they ship. They ship antiques almost on a daily basis! They have also used railway for larger orders, but it makes the most sense for shipping large orders going across the country. They ensure their shipments are extremely padded and even double box at times for protection. They may use a wood skid for your furniture items that have legs. They are certified to ship overseas!

Furthermore, they’re a drop site for Fed Ex, UPS, and DHL.
